About

'I have heard it said that a spirit enters' is the first recording of orchestral music by Gavin Bryars on his own label. It includes two pieces for string orchestra (his Violin Concerto and The Porazzi Fragment) in their premiere recordings, supervised by the composer, and jazz-related works for chamber orchestra and soloists – jazz vocalist Holly Cole, and Gavin Bryars himself in a rare appearance as a jazz bassist.

Gavin Bryars lives part of the year on the west coast of Canada and has strong links with many areas of Canadian music and culture. This recording features his work with the CBC Radio Orchestra, the last radio orchestra in North America, which has since been disbanded. The whole of this programme was given as the last night of the 2002 Vancouver International Jazz Festival featuring, as it does, his songs for the Canadian jazz singer Holly Cole, and with Bryars himself playing the piece for double-bass and orchestra, By the Vaar, that he wrote for Charlie Haden.

The album was originally released on CBC Records in 2002 but was deleted during the financial cuts at CBC. It has been substantially re-mastered and redesigned for GB Records.
